That it was. And while on the subject
[CRAZY SPOILERS TO
FOLLOW]
The scene where Anna offs
Samara was insanely graphic. Even with the plastic over her face
Samara wouldn't die, so Anna picks up a rock and bashes her daughter
over and over. There was also supposed to be a shot where she lugs
Samara's body over the lip of the well, and it smacks into the side
of it on the way down.
